What is the Martindale Test?

The Martindale Test is a widely used method for evaluating the abrasion resistance of textiles. Named after its inventor, Dr. Martindale, this test simulates the wear and tear fabrics experience in real-life scenarios. It involves subjecting a fabric sample to repeated rubbing against a standard abrasive material under controlled conditions.

This process measures how well the fabric can withstand friction before showing visible signs of wear or damage. The results are expressed in terms of rub counts, with higher counts indicating greater resistance to abrasion. This test is particularly valuable for industries producing upholstery, clothing, and technical textiles.

Why is Abrasion Resistance Important?

Abrasion resistance is a critical attribute for textiles, as it directly impacts the lifespan and functionality of products. Consumers expect their clothing, furniture, and other fabric-based items to endure daily use without showing signs of wear prematurely.

Poor abrasion resistance can lead to pilling, thinning, or complete failure of the fabric, which can tarnish a brand’s reputation. By conducting the Martindale Test, manufacturers can ensure their products meet durability standards, enhance customer satisfaction, and minimize returns or complaints.

How Does the Martindale Abrasion Tester Work?

The Martindale Abrasion Tester is the equipment used to conduct the Martindale Test. It operates by applying controlled friction to a fabric sample in a circular motion. The tester comprises a flat surface where the fabric sample is placed, along with an abrasive material (such as sandpaper or wool) that rubs against the sample.

Key features of the tester include adjustable pressure settings, interchangeable abrasive materials, and counters to track the number of rubs. Technicians assess the fabric’s performance by observing when visible damage occurs or when the fabric loses its functional properties, such as strength or appearance.

This machine is widely used in laboratories and quality control centers, ensuring that textiles meet industry standards before reaching consumers.

Interpreting Martindale Test Results

Understanding the results of the Martindale Test is essential for making informed decisions about fabric selection and product development. Abrasion resistance is measured in cycles or rub counts, and the higher the count, the more durable the fabric.

For instance, fabrics with a rub count of 15,000 or higher are considered highly durable and are often used for heavy-duty applications like commercial upholstery. On the other hand, fabrics with lower rub counts are better suited for decorative purposes or light use.

Manufacturers can use these insights to select the appropriate materials for their target audience and intended applications, ensuring that products meet both functional and aesthetic expectations.

1. What is the difference between pilling and abrasion?

Pilling refers to the formation of small, fuzzy balls on the fabric surface due to fiber entanglement, while abrasion is the physical wear and tear of the fabric caused by friction or rubbing.

3. What is the Martindale pilling test?

The Martindale pilling test evaluates a fabric's resistance to pilling under controlled conditions using the same Martindale equipment. This test assesses how well a fabric maintains its appearance despite wear.
